Nutrition & fruit protection
Currently we have over 50 hectares of early stone fruit under nets. This protects the orchards form frost, wind and potential hail and helps us to guarantee early summer fruit to our customers.
Fertigation improves the water and nutrient uptake of trees. We apply it on all new developments and, depending on annual soil and leaf samples, scientifically calculate how much fertiliser needs to be added to the water. This enriched solution is applied via drip irrigation, ensuring it reaches the roots of the trees without wastage caused by evaporation and leaching. We are able to also adjust the pH and EC (electrical conductivity) of the water to ensure optimum flavour in the fruit. To further guarantee the long-term health and viability of the orchards, we use organic compost tea.
Every farmer knows what valuable resource water is and in South Africa it is particularly scarce. We therefore test soil moisture with a capacitance sensor, in conjunction with daily evapotranspiration readings to determine irrigation volumes and to prevent further water wastage.
on the forefront of varietal innovation
Every year we travel the world over in search of new cultivars that would be suitable for our climate and soil. It keeps us at the forefront of innovation. We have tested over 400 new varieties each year we test more.
